With a population of just 45,827, Prescott boasts itself as the "World's Oldest Rodeo" city, but the reality is a persistent bureaucratic headache for residents. While the city touts its historic charm, frequent wildfires and flash floods pose serious risks. And despite the region's natural beauty, the climate can be extreme, with temperatures swinging wildly between blistering summer days and frigid winter nights. This rugged frontier town is best suited for hardy outdoor enthusiasts willing to navigate its quirks.
